THREE IDEAS TO DEAL WITH GETTING COLD FEET ON THE D-DAY – SOUMYA JAIN


 

Cold Feet or pre-wedding jitters are normal for every bride-to-be. As the big day gets closer, anything can freak you out. The best way to deal with cold feet is to soak them in warm water. Just kidding! (laughs)

Here are three ways of getting over the chills from the wedding madness –

1. Think of the future you have planned with your to-be partner. Picture your life together and all the adventures, moments, experiences you will share together, especially the honeymoon. These thoughts will instantly shake you off the jitters.

2. Think of all the reasons why you love your partner. Think of all the qualities that attract you to him and make you smile. Think of the fact that you’re going to be welcomed in a whole new family. All of this will boost your mood and make you look forward to what’s on cards.

3. Last but not the least, you must pamper yourself and relax during all the hustle of the wedding planning. Take a spa day and unwind. There’s nothing like self-care!
